Koontz originally published the novel under the pseudonym Owen West. As the film production took longer than expected, the book was released before the film. Block) screenplay, which was made into the 1981 film The Funhouse, directed by Tobe Hooper. The Funhouse is a 1980 novelization by American author Dean Koontz, based on a Larry Block (aka Lawrence J.
